Output 7a666319d52c3ecd77dc34ef6a26839d23602cbb684c4f22a022f80e32eb1879:28

value
4039814
script pubkey
OP_0 OP_PUSHBYTES_32 1975b4898e49d5a03d7025bf7def172f8c653f9fd07e886409d624e670f394aa
address
bc1qr96mfzvwf826q0tsyklhmmch97xx20ul6plgseqf6cjwvu8njj4qydfefz
transaction
7a666319d52c3ecd77dc34ef6a26839d23602cbb684c4f22a022f80e32eb1879
spent
true